YDT Words

YDT Frequently Used Words with Example Sentences and Turkish Meanings

Academic Verbs

  1. assume (varsaymak)
    Scientists often assume that climate change will accelerate in the coming decades.
  2. assess (değerlendirmek)
    Experts must assess the potential risks before launching the project.
  3. conduct (yürütmek)
    The researchers will conduct a detailed survey on consumer behavior.
  4. maintain (sürdürmek)
    It is essential to maintain a balanced diet for a healthy life.
  5. indicate (belirtmek, göstermek)
    Recent studies indicate a strong link between stress and heart disease.
  6. achieve (başarmak)
    The company aims to achieve its environmental goals by 2030.
  7. justify (haklı göstermek)
    He tried to justify his decision by explaining the circumstances.
  8. acknowledge (kabul etmek)
    She refused to acknowledge that she had made a mistake.
  9. emphasize (vurgulamak)
    The report emphasizes the importance of early intervention.
  10. contribute (katkıda bulunmak)
    Volunteers contribute significantly to community development.
  11. define (tanımlamak)
    The term ‘biodiversity’ can be defined in various ways.
  12. emerge (ortaya çıkmak)
    New technologies have emerged in the field of renewable energy.
  13. perceive (algılamak)
    Children often perceive the world differently from adults.
  14. predict (tahmin etmek)
    Economists predict a slow recovery in the global market.
  15. determine (belirlemek)
    The test results will determine whether the treatment is effective.

Connectors & Linking Words

  1. although (–e rağmen, -dığı halde)
    Although it was raining, they continued their journey.
  2. whereas (halbuki, oysa ki)
    Some people prefer working alone, whereas others enjoy teamwork.
  3. therefore (bu yüzden, dolayısıyla)
    The evidence was insufficient; therefore, the case was dismissed.
  4. however (ancak, yine de)
    The plan seems reasonable; however, it may be too costly.
  5. moreover (üstelik, ayrıca)
    The project is innovative; moreover, it is cost-effective.
  6. consequently (sonuç olarak, bu nedenle)
    The factory closed down; consequently, many workers lost their jobs.
  7. in addition (ilaveten, ayrıca)
    In addition to English, she speaks Spanish fluently.
  8. nevertheless (yine de, buna rağmen)
    The task was difficult; nevertheless, he completed it successfully.
  9. thus (böylece, bu yüzden)
    The experiment failed; thus, a new approach was necessary.
  10. despite (-e rağmen)
    Despite his efforts, the problem remained unsolved.
  11. due to (-den dolayı)
    The match was postponed due to heavy snowfall.
  12. as a result (sonuç olarak)
    The company invested heavily; as a result, profits increased.
  13. in contrast (aksine, buna karşılık)
    In contrast to last year, sales have improved significantly.
  14. furthermore (ayrıca, bunun yanında)
    The findings are reliable; furthermore, they are consistent.
  15. on the other hand (öte yandan)
    Urban areas are crowded; on the other hand, they offer more opportunities.

Adjectives Common in Passages

  1. significant (önemli)
    There was a significant increase in the number of applicants.
  2. efficient (verimli, etkili)
    Solar panels are becoming more efficient every year.
  3. widespread (yaygın)
    Internet access is widespread in most developed countries.
  4. inevitable (kaçınılmaz)
    Technological change is inevitable in modern societies.
  5. relevant (ilgili)
    The data provided was not relevant to the discussion.
  6. considerable (önemli ölçüde, dikkate değer)
    They invested a considerable amount of money in research.
  7. temporary (geçici)
    The shelter provided only temporary accommodation.
  8. permanent (kalıcı)
    The museum houses a permanent collection of ancient artifacts.
  9. sustainable (sürdürülebilir)
    Sustainable practices help protect natural resources.
  10. accessible (erişilebilir, ulaşılabilir)
    The website should be accessible to all users.

Common Nouns

  1. impact (etki)
    The new policy had a positive impact on the environment.
  2. approach (yaklaşım)
    Their approach to the problem was innovative and effective.
  3. evidence (kanıt, delil)
    There is no clear evidence to support the claim.
  4. issue (sorun, mesele)
    Pollution is a serious issue in many big cities.
  5. trend (eğilim)
    There is a growing trend towards healthier lifestyles.
  6. factor (etken, faktör)
    Cost is an important factor in choosing a product.
  7. aspect (yön, açı)
    The economic aspect of the project must be considered.
  8. policy (politika)
    The government introduced a new education policy.
  9. resource (kaynak)
    Water is a vital natural resource.
  10. population (nüfus)
    The population of the city has doubled in the last decade.

🔍 Phrasal Verbs

  1. carry out (yürütmek, gerçekleştirmek)
    The scientists will carry out further experiments.
  2. put forward (ileri sürmek, ortaya atmak)
    Several theories have been put forward to explain the phenomenon.
  3. turn out (sonuçlanmak, ortaya çıkmak)
    It turned out that the information was incorrect.
  4. come up with (bulmak, ortaya atmak)
    They need to come up with a better solution.
  5. give rise to (sebep olmak, yol açmak)
    Industrial activities often give rise to pollution.
  6. set up (kurmak, düzenlemek)
    The organization was set up to support local artists.
  7. take part in (katılmak)
    Hundreds of students will take part in the competition.
  8. deal with (ilgilenmek, ele almak)
    The manager had to deal with several complaints.

Miscellaneous High-Frequency Words

  1. enable (olanak tanımak, imkân vermek)
    New technologies enable people to work remotely.
  2. obtain (elde etmek)
    It is difficult to obtain accurate data.
  3. restrict (sınırlamak, kısıtlamak)
    The law restricts access to confidential information.
  4. enhance (artırmak, geliştirmek)
    Good communication skills can enhance career prospects.
  5. decline (azalmak, gerilemek)
    There has been a decline in birth rates.
  6. challenge (zorluk, meydan okuma)
    Climate change poses a serious challenge to humanity.
  7. require (gerektirmek)
    The course requires a basic knowledge of biology.
  8. expand (genişlemek, genişletmek)
    The company plans to expand into new markets.
  9. adopt (benimsemek, kabul etmek)
    They decided to adopt a different strategy.
  10. retain (korumak, muhafaza etmek)
    It is important to retain talented employees.
